The dean of a college of business wants to create some marketing materials to advertise its MBA in finance. The university sends a survey to a random sample of individuals with who are mutual fund managers for large investment firms. The survey asked two questions: "What was the rank of your MBA program" and "Did your funds outperform the market last year?" The responses were entered into a 3 x 2 contingency table such as the one shown below.
What value of the chi-squared distribution marks the rejection region for a test at the 0.05 level of significance?
Hint: You don't need the actual data in the table to find this. You just need the dimensions of the table.

Explanation / Answer
Degrees of freedom = (3-1)(2-1)= 2
So critical value for chi square 2 df at 0.05 level is 5.991.
If test statistics value > 5.991(critical value) then we can reject H0.
Rejection region is > 5.991
